Local Flavors and Artistry: Sampling Unique Traditions Beyond Major Cities
Venturing outside the bustling streets of major cities reveals an array of local flavors and rich traditions that deserve recognition. From quirky food festivals celebrating forgotten culinary arts to art fairs showcasing indigenous craftsmanship, these hidden gems often embody the soul of American culture. as a notable example, the Chowder Festival in Newport, Rhode Island features local chefs competing with their best seafood recipes, providing visitors a chance to taste authentic regional cuisine while enjoying the coastal charm of the area.
Cultural festivities frequently enough blend food, music, and artistry, showcasing the uniqueness of each locale. Consider attending the Pineapple Festival in Georgia, where the community embraces its agricultural roots through pineapple-themed dishes, crafts, and live performances. the small-town atmosphere invites participation, allowing visitors to chat with local artists and savor signature dishes that might not be found elsewhere. Such festivals create an intimate experience that’s often absent in larger, more commercial gatherings.
Here’s a glimpse of some standout festivals worth exploring:
| Festival | Location | Highlight |
|---|---|---|
| Watermelon festival | Sidney,Ohio | watermelon-themed games and contests |
| Folk Art Festival | Santa Fe,New Mexico | Local artisans display unique handmade crafts |
| Apple Harvest Festival | biglerville,Pennsylvania | Apple picking,cider tasting,and pie contests |

Tips for Travelers: How to Immerse Yourself in Cultural Festivities Like a Local
To truly connect with the heart and soul of a cultural festival, consider venturing off the typical tourist trail. seek out local events in smaller towns where community spirit shines bright. As an example, explore county fairs that showcase regional crafts, local cuisine, and traditional music. Engage with residents by asking them about their stories and experiences related to the festival; this personal touch can offer insights that guidebooks often overlook.
Participating actively is key to immersing yourself in these experiences.here are some suggestions:
- Volunteer: Offer your time at the festival. Many small events rely heavily on volunteers, and this hands-on involvement immerses you closely into local practices.
- Join Workshops: Look for workshops or classes local to the festival—be it cooking, crafting, or dancing traditional styles. Partaking in these activities enhances your appreciation for the culture.
- Try Local Delicacies: Dive into the culinary aspect by sampling street food and regional specialties. Don’t be afraid to ask locals for their recommendations!
For a practical touch, consider taking part in unique celebrations highlighted for their authenticity. Below is a table showcasing a few lesser-known cultural festivals that offer a fantastic chance to engage with locals:
| Festival Name | Location | Date | Highlight |
|---|---|---|---|
| Hiawatha Music Festival | Marquette,MI | August | Roots and folk music by the shores of lake Superior |
| World Chicken Festival | London,KY | September | Celebration of all things chicken with a unique heritage |
| Gilroy Garlic Festival | Gilroy,CA | July | A tasty ode to garlic with cooking competitions |
